PSG Faces Major Setback Ahead of Barcelona Clash

Par

le


The anticipation for the clash between Paris Saint-Germain (PSG) and FC Barcelona is reaching fever pitch as fans across Africa and beyond prepare for one of the most exciting fixtures in European football. Scheduled for tomorrow evening at 21:00, the match promises to be a thrilling encounter, but not without its challenges for PSG.

In a surprising twist, PSG has announced that key player Khvicha Kvaratskhelia will miss the game due to injury. The talented winger suffered a setback during their recent match against Auxerre, joining an already lengthy injury list that includes Marquinhos, Ousmane Dembélé, and Desiré Dou. This news comes as a shock to fans who were eager to see Kvaratskhelia’s dynamic playmaking skills on display against one of their fiercest rivals.

However, there is some good news for coach Luis Enrique. Both João Neves and Fabián Ruiz have returned to the squad, providing vital reinforcements. Most notably, there was uncertainty surrounding Vitinha, but he has made the cut and will be available to contribute against Barcelona. His presence in midfield could be pivotal as PSG looks to control possession and dictate play.
